Responsibilities
Participate in new product development and obsolescence recovery efforts.
Translate customer and product requirements into documentation for parts and materials procurement, product manufacturing, and testing.
Perform mechanical, electrical, reliability, FMEA, EMC, and DFMAT analyses to optimize new product designs within schedule and cost objectives.
Prepare product design review documents and design analysis reports. Make effective presentations to internal and external customers.
Qualify new products and write qualification reports.
Generate and review manufacturing documents for assigned programs and products. Support manufacturing for correct implementation of the design.
Work with CAD design team to generate and update part and assembly documentation needed for procurement, manufacturing, and assembly.
Identify long lead materials, tooling, and testing requirements for the product.
Generate product Bill of Materials (BOM).
Interact with suppliers and peer groups within Spectrolab for accurate and timely realization of the product.
Perform the necessary analyses and heritage assessments.
Develop test plans as needed to verify design conformance to requirements.
Work with manufacturing, planning, procurement, and suppliers to assess planning and production issues as they emerge. Provide clear and concise decisions and dispositions.
Provide technical support to purchasing, marketing, and customers.
Perform product non-conformance and failure analysis; identify and lead implementation of appropriate corrective actions and hardware dispositions.
Assess product and process performance and identify opportunities for continuous improvement in product, cost, schedule, and market capture performance.
